- [ ] **Step 7: Breaker override escrow.** After sealing the signing keys for the Tallgrove upstream API circuit breaker, confirm the support team can force the breaker open during a full outage. The override bundle lives in the sealed escrow drawer and is useless without its unlock phrase. Two ceremony witnesses must initial this step before proceeding. The escrow bundle is decrypted with the recovery passphrase that follows.

vault phrase of kahip-kahop = holath-quenmir

**Action item (P1): Enforce per-tenant rate quotas in Gatewright**

Reviewers: confirm the quota middleware reads tenant limits from config at request time, not at startup, so updates apply without a redeploy. Verify the fallback default is conservative and that exceeding tenants receive a retry-after header. Acceptance criteria and the quota schema are documented on the internal page below.

wiki page, tajeg-hafog: https://confluence.lumicsys.internal/browse/projects/projects/browse/3d9b

Q: Why does Splitglass refuse to render my diff on files over 50MB?

A: By design. Large-file diffs fall back to chunked mode: you get per-hunk rendering with lazy loading instead of a full side-by-side view. Binary files show hashes only. You can raise the threshold per-repo with a config flag, but reviews get slow fast. Threshold settings and chunked-mode caveats are explained on this page.

wiki page, tahaf-tajog: https://jira.ordindyn.corp/pipeline